Hike along one of the 18 trails at Allegany State Park. 3 trails are self-guided nature trails and if you want an easy stroll, there's 3.1 miles of paved trail around Red House Lake.
Go back in time and watch a movie on one of the large screens outside. Grab your lawn chairs, blankets, and your favorite snacks at the concession stands available on-site. The Enchanted Mountains offers two drive-ins, Delevan Twin Drive-In Theater and Portville Drive-In.
Join Next Level Mountain Biking for the first "bike" of the year!
Meet at Camp Allegany at 11am on January 1st, 2026. The pace and length of the ride will be moderate or determined by the riders. Participants may split into two different groups so that no one gets left behind.
Fat Tire bikes are advised, given the conditions of the trails that may be present.
